SIDORE v. 334 E. 5TH ST.

9583. 160738/17.

174 A.D.3d 403 (2019)

101 N.Y.S.3d 606

2019 NY Slip Op 05321

Micala Sidore, Appellant, v. 334 East 5th Street, Respondent.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, First Department.

Decided July 2, 2019.


The court properly awarded defendant summary judgment, upon a search of the record, based on the doctrine of laches (see Capruso v Village of Kings Point, 23 N.Y.3d 631, 641 [2014]). Based on the grant of summary judgment to defendant, defendant was entitled to a declaration that the number of shares of stock allocated to plaintiff's unit is 300.
